Tesla imposes congestion charges at Superchargers

This post is also available in: 简体中文 (Chinese)

Tesla is implementing Supercharger congestion pricing in response to a surge in demand for electric vehicle charging stations.

The new fee replaces the previous inactivity fee, which increased from $0.50 to $1 per minute, and only applies to Tesla Supercharger stations in the United States.

This fee is mainly targeted at stations with heavy traffic, with particular focus on locations with high charging station traffic. The move could penalize owners for overcharging, especially if the battery charge exceeds 90%. Owners will receive notifications via the Tesla app giving them advance notice of upcoming congestion charges.

The move is part of Tesla’s strategy to expand Supercharger stations to better cope with growing demand for electric vehicle charging infrastructure.
